Radiology Information Systems (RIS) Industry Overview
Artificial Intelligence, Workflow Automation, and Intelligent Imaging Operations Are Transforming the Radiology Information Systems Industry
The radiology information systems industry is undergoing rapid evolution driven by artificial intelligence, workflow orchestration technologies, and the increasing operational complexity of diagnostic imaging departments. Healthcare providers are increasingly adopting intelligent RIS platforms capable of automating administrative workflows, accelerating reporting processes, and improving interoperability across imaging ecosystems. As imaging volumes continue to rise globally, radiology departments are prioritizing technologies that reduce operational burden, optimize resource utilization, and enhance clinical productivity through advanced automation and integrated healthcare information management.
Generative Artificial Intelligence Is Reshaping Radiology Reporting Workflows
The integration of generative artificial intelligence into radiology workflows represents one of the most significant technological shifts affecting diagnostic imaging operations. Healthcare organizations are increasingly deploying AI-powered reporting tools that automate documentation tasks while enabling radiologists to focus on clinical interpretation and decision-making. This trend is exemplified by DeepHealth's introduction of Reporting Pro, which utilizes generative AI to organize clinical findings, quantitative measurements, and imaging abnormalities into structured draft reports across multiple imaging modalities. The adoption of such technologies reflects the broader industry movement toward reducing reporting turnaround times and improving radiologist efficiency.
Agentic Artificial Intelligence Is Expanding Operational Automation
Radiology information systems are increasingly evolving beyond traditional image management platforms into intelligent operational ecosystems capable of autonomous workflow execution. Emerging agentic artificial intelligence architectures are enabling the automation of multiple administrative and operational functions simultaneously. This trend is demonstrated by IMEXHS Limited's deployment of its agentic AI platform within the Aquila+ RIS/PACS environment, where multiple proprietary AI agents automate tasks including study scheduling, case triage, and report distribution. The implementation of autonomous workflow technologies highlights the industry's broader transition toward intelligent operational management within radiology departments.
Integrated Healthcare IT Platforms Are Supporting High-Volume Imaging Environments
The continued growth in diagnostic imaging utilization is driving demand for integrated healthcare information platforms capable of managing increasingly complex clinical workflows. Healthcare technology providers are developing solutions that combine radiology information management, artificial intelligence, and workflow optimization within unified ecosystems. This trend is reflected by FUJIFILM India's introduction of the Fenix healthcare IT platform, which integrates radiology information system functionality with AI-enabled workflow automation capabilities. The development of comprehensive imaging management platforms underscores the industry's focus on improving operational efficiency, enhancing interoperability, and supporting the growing demands of modern diagnostic imaging services.

France Market Size, Growth Rate, and Forecast Analysis to 2034- Universal healthcare system, high public healthcare expenditure, and strong government support Radiology Information Systems sales through 2034
France Radiology Information Systems companies are emphasizing on opportunities for rapid, at-scale innovation to boost profitability over the long-term. The country’s National Health Insurance spending target (ONDAM) estimates 3.7% growth in the country’s healthcare expenditure. Over the forecast period, expenditure control measures, chronic disease management initiatives, workforce reforms, and efforts to improve system efficiency drive the long-term prospects.
The biggest 2026 policy frame is the PLFSS 2026. The law sets the Maladie branch spending target at €271.4 billion for 2026 and fixes the ONDAM at €117.5 billion for city care, €112.8 billion for health establishments, and €18.3 billion for elderly-care establishments and services. France’s market is also being pulled by demographics. INSEE estimates that on 1 January 2026 France had 69.1 million inhabitants, with 22% aged 65 or over. INSEE also reported that 2025 births were 645,000 and deaths were 651,000, producing a negative natural balance of about 6,000 for the first time since the end of the Second World War.
